description Oboz Sawtooth X Low Overview

The Oboz Sawtooth X Low is a standout for its exceptional 'O Fit' insole, which provides more arch support and cushioning than almost any other stock insole on the market. The shoe is built like a tank, with a durable nubuck leather upper and a high-traction outsole that performs well on mud and loose dirt. It is a fantastic choice for hikers who suffer from plantar fasciitis or those who simply want a shoe that feels supportive and structured from the very first mile. It is a reliable, long-lasting workhorse for any trail.

recommend Best for: Hikers seeking a robust, supportive shoe for mixed terrain who prioritize arch support and durability over lightweight or fully waterproof performance.

balance Oboz Sawtooth X Low Pros & Cons

thumb_up Pros
  • check Exceptional O Fit insole delivers superior arch support and cushioning, rivaling many aftermarket footbeds
  • check Durable nubuck leather upper withstands rough terrain and resists abrasions
  • check Hightraction outsole with multidirectional lugs provides confident grip on mud, loose soil, and rocky paths
  • check Dualdensity EVA midsole offers a balanced blend of shock absorption and stability
  • check Reinforced toe cap protects against rock impacts and trail debris
  • check Breathable mesh panels enhance airflow to keep feet cooler on long hikes
thumb_down Cons
  • close Heavier than typical trail running shoes, adding fatigue on long distance hikes
  • close Nubuck leather requires a short breakin period to fully soften and conform to the foot
  • close Not fully waterproof; lacks a membrane, so feet may get wet in heavy rain or stream crossings
  • close Limited color and style options compared to more fashionoriented hiking lines
  • close Price point is higher than many entrylevel hiking shoes, positioning it as a premium option

help Oboz Sawtooth X Low FAQ

Is the Oboz Sawtooth X Low waterproof?

The Sawtooth X Low does not include a waterproof membrane. It uses nubuck leather and mesh for breathability, so while it can handle light moisture, it will soak through in heavy rain or stream crossings.

How does the O Fit insole compare to custom orthotics?

The O Fit insole offers a contoured arch and medium cushioning that works well for many hikers. For severe foot deformities or specific orthotic needs, custom orthotics may still be required for optimal support.

What is the weight of the Sawtooth X Low?

A single shoe in a mens size 9 weighs approximately 14oz (400g). This is slightly heavier than minimalist trail runners but comparable to other leatherconstructed hiking shoes.

Does the shoe have a rock plate?

The Sawtooth X Low relies on its sturdy nubuck leather and the stiffened EVA midsole for protection. While it does not feature a dedicated rigid rock plate, the overall construction provides decent underfoot protection on rocky terrain.

How does sizing run compared to other Oboz models?

The Sawtooth X Low generally runs true to size for Oboz footwear. If you are between sizes, many reviewers recommend sizing half a size up, especially if you plan to wear thicker hiking socks.

What are the key specifications of Oboz Sawtooth X Low?
  • Drop: 8mm (heeltotoe offset)
  • Insole: O Fit contoured insole with arch support
  • Closure: Traditional laceup
  • Midsole: Dualdensity EVA foam
  • Outsole: Oboz HighTrac rubber with multidirectional 4mm lugs
  • Lace System: Standard flat laces with webbing loops
